Effects Of Different Seedling Transplanting On Growth And Developme Nt And Yield And Quality Of Flue-cured Tobacco

In order to explore the effect of different seedling transplanting on the growth and yield and quality of flue-cured tobacco,K326 was used as experimental material.Five different seedling treatments were romdamly arranged by field experiment,a nd been transplanted when the age of seedling is 4 leaves,5 leaves,6 leaves,7 leaves and 8leaves.The agronomic traits of the flue-cured tobacco during the growing period were measured,and the dry matter accumulation of the samples was measured.The analysis of internal chemical composition and sensory quality of the initial flue-cured tobacco leaves came to the results:1.Different seedling transplanting on the growth and development of flue-cured tobacco during the agronomic traits were significantly influenced.In the whole process of flue-cured tobacco growth and development,plant height increased with the increase of seedling age in the long period of flue-cured tobacco;stem circumference decreased with the increase of seedling age;leaf number did not change with the increase of seedling age.Every period of duration were all kept within an appropriate range: the leaf length,leaf width and leaf area of the upper,middle and lower leaves decreased with the increase of seedling age.2.The leaf area coefficient increased with the increase of seedling age,but the lea f area coefficient decreased with the increase of seedling age.The photosynthetic potential increased first and then decreased with the increase of seedling age in flue-cured tobacco field.The total photosynthetic potential of different periods of processed duration was significant.3.Dry matter accumulation of flue-cured tobacco is different under the transplant o n different seedling ages.There was no significant difference in dry matter accumulation in the middle part and upper part of flue-cured tobacco and dry matter accumulation in the lower part of flue-cured tobacco leaves during the different seedling ages.With the growth and development of flue-cured tobacco,the dry matter accumulation showed difference within vigorous growing stage,squaring stage and mature stage,and they followed the same law.The dry matter accumulation in the upper,middle,lower and aboveground areas decreased with the increase of seedling age.4.After 60 days of transplanting,every value of processed MLIA showed the trend that increased first and then decreased with the increase of seedling age.The values of every processed extinction coefficient K were as follows: increased with the growth and development,and the value of K shows the trend that increased with the increase of seedling age.5.The contents of the chemical components in the leaves of the roasted leaves were different.The effects of different ages on the total sugar content of flue-cured tobacco were not obvious.Except for the upper leaf content,the contents of the middle leaves and the lower leaves were in the proper range: the content of reducing sugar decreased with the increase of seedling age;the content of starch was not significant;the nicotine content of upper and middle leaves of flue-cured tobacco increased first and then decreased with the increase of seedling age.The content of potassium in upper and middle leaves of flue-cured tobacco decreased with the increase of seedling age.The effects of different seedling age on the total nitrogen content in the middle leaves of flue-cured tobacco were more obvious,which decreased with the increase of seedling age.6.The results showed that the economic traits of flue-cured tobacco had a significant effect on the yield of flue-cured tobacco,the value of yield,the proportion of upper-class tobacco,middle-class tobacco and so on.The economic traits were A2> A3> A1> A4> A5.The increase of seedling age increased first and then decreas ed.The yield was the highest when the leaves is 5,the value is 2122 kg / hm2,the output value was 63384 yuan / hm2,and the proportion of medium to medium smoke was 89.22%.Different seedling treatments had an important effect on the population structure and individual development of flue-cured tobacco.Appropriate seedling transplanting could improve the coordination of chemical composition of flue-cured tobacco,play a positive role in the balance of flue-cured tobacco production and the sensory quality of flue-cured tobacco.Through the comprehensive analysis,it is suggested that the individual plants of transplanted tobacco growed best when the leaves is 5,which provides a theoretical basis for optimizing the cultivation techniques of flue-cured tobacco,and provides technical guidance for the refined production of tobacco leaves in Q ujing base,and on the other hand,it is of great significance to improve the protection of great special tobacco raw material supply in Guangdong.
